Hey guys, anyone have any ideas here? Ever since I been in Az with this truck, after warming up the idle has been up around 1000 or so when coming to a stop. After being stopped for a few seconds, 10-15 i guess, it will drop to around 800. Seems worse with the A/C on. I know the computer will kick up the idle with the A/C, but this seems like excessive. I am wondering if the computer is wrong for this altitude, around 4500 - 5000 feet. I am not at all savy about computer controlled engines.
 






It does not sound that far out of pace for what they do. When I lived in Phx, that seemed to be normal, as compared to up here at much higher altitudes.
